How to navigate a tricky PPP loan situation
Posted 04/27/2020

From Inc. This Morning

More than 25 million people in the U.S. have filed for unemployment benefits in the past several weeks. If your workers are among them, what does that mean for how you can use a Paycheck Protection Program loan? And if you’re self-employed, can you double-dip, with unemployment benefits and a PPP loan? 

Inc.’s exclusive National Small Business Town Hall Friday put these questions and many more to a panel of business experts. (No, you can’t double-dip.) They offered critical tips, including how to bring back employees who are reluctant to come back. You might want to consider offering hazard pay bonuses, says Sarah Jennings, a director at accounting firm Maner Costerisan.
